The OLNE Relationship Podcast is a relationship advice show for people who want love without ownership, intimacy without control, and freedom without chaos. It explores relationships, emotional intelligence, jealousy, attachment, communication, dating, breakups, personal growth, and the deeper psychology of love. Each episode offers practical insight for building relationships rooted in honesty, self-awareness, nonconditional love, and mutual respect.
